Femi Adebayo Appreciates Kwara State Governor, And Babatunde Raji Fashola For Appearing At 'HER EXCELLENCY' Premiere
Popular Nollywood actor, Femi Adebayo, has penned an appreciation message to the Governor of Kwara State, Abdul Rahman Abdul Razaq, and the former Governor of Lagos State, Babatunde Raji Fashola, SAN, following their appearance at the premiere of his father's upcoming tribute movie 'HER EXCELLENCY' on Sunday at IMAX Cinemas, Lekki, Lagos.
The Nigerian Voice recalls that 'HER EXCELLENCY' tribute film is a special project dedicated to honour veteran actor, Adebayo Salami AKA Oga Bello's 60 years in Nollywood, with his son, Femi Adebayo, directing the movie, which features a star-studded cast including Femi Adebayo, Adebayo Salami, Sola Sobowale, Odunlade Adekola, and many more.
Femi Adebayo revealed last Thursday, that the official trailer of the movie is out.
Sharing clips from the well-attended event on Sunday, Femi Adebayo revealed his excitement at receiving the two dignitaries at the star-studded premiere of 'HER EXCELLENCY.'
He described the moment as "a true celebration of legacy, excellence, and unforgettable drama."
He appreciated everyone who honoured, and supported the process.
He wrote:
"Super excited to receive the Honourable Governor of Kwara State - H.E. Abdul Rahman Abdul Razaq and the Former Governor of Lagos State - H.E. Babatunde Raji Fashola SAN at the star-studded premiere of HER EXCELLENCY
Hosted by my father, mentor, and icon @adebayo.salami, this moment was nothing short of grand - a true celebration of legacy, excellence, and unforgettable cinema.
Grateful for the honour, the support, and the presence of greatness.
#HerExcellencyPremiere."
